Who owns the designs once they're finished?
You do! Once your payment for a month of service is complete, your church fully owns the final files we worked on (e.g., the PDF bulletin, the JPG sermon graphic, QuickBooks files).
We retain the rights to our internal working files, like our design templates. We also reserve the right to showcase the work in our portfolio, with church names anonymized, to help other ministries see what's possible. As a courtesy, we also keep a backup of your final files for one year, just in case you ever misplace anything.
How does the pricing work? Is this a long-term contract?
We believe in simplicity and trust. All our packages are a flat, predictable monthly fee so you can easily budget for them. We generally use a simple 30-day rolling agreement (outside of special projects), which means you're never locked into a long-term contract. You can adjust or cancel your plan with 30 days' notice.
